Parts list: № Number Qty Name Options Next page: ST607831 1603 (FUEL INJECTION PUMP) ST609878 1601 (FUEL INJECTION PUMP) ST609880 SOLENOID SWITCH ST609885 1602 (FUEL INJECTION NOZZLES AND LINES) ST609887 1602 (FUEL INJECTION PUMP) (ESN (AF) 068145- ; (HF) ALL ) (068145 - )